Leveraging GenAI to analyze realtime video to quickly respond to accidents in the workplace

Ensuring the safety of workers in manufacturing and construction, and responding quickly to incident events, has become a pressing challenge. Traditional CCTV monitoring has limitations, as the number of the cameras are bound to the number of personnel for visual surveillance. And while conventional machine learning algorithms can analyze videos, they often require extensive training on specific event types. This presentation will demonstrate a system that leverages AWS Cloud services to address these challenges. By feeding video stream into a generative AI model, the system can analyze the captured situations in real-time and provide alerts. Unlike conventional AI, this approach does not need to be trained on each type of incident. Instead, it can adaptively adjust its behavior to flexibly detect dangerous situations like accidents and injuries. This helps reduce the manpower required for constant monitoring, while enabling swift response.
